classes
There are 3 classes: Mage, S-rank/Elite Mage, and Legendary mage.
To start, everyone is a mage.
Increasing your class allows you to further improve your character and stretch your limits as to how strong your character can get, for example increasing the number of S-rank skills you can have. Although improving your class does not give you more power it does give you access to more power.
Additionally, one can not improve their class by doing a bunch of missions. The only way to improve your class is through rp...a lot of rp...like seriously crazy development rp. In order to become elite your character must be real character. One can not power play to S-rank or Legendary status and is expected to rp here. Basically the better your story the more likely you'll be approved for improving your class.
Titles
Titles are another way of increasing your power as a mage. Acquiring a title can give you access to special spells, special powers, weapons, and a various assortment of other boosts. There are responsibilities that come with these boosts though.
Guildmaster: Guildmasters are the leaders of a guild, be they dark and good or on the toilet they lead the guilds. Guildmasters have the most power of all other titles available OOC and are able to view(although not post in) the staff section. Guildmasters are also able to make guild spell for their guild which are the ultimate weapons of the guild and have access to all of the guild spells of their guild. IC guild masters have the power to make decisions that involve their guild which include but are not limited to assigning aces and buying stuff for your guild. Most legal guild masters also have political power while dark guild masters are the equivalent to underworld leaders.
Guildmasters are also expected to take care of their guild and its members. Helping new members get accustomed to the site and should they ask for assistance IC wise you should be the first person they ask and can go to. If uncertain how to solve the problem send htem to staff we are happy to help.
